Maintenance and Care: A Comparative Insight

The Homestyles General Line Kitchen Mobile Cart, crafted from natural hardwood, requires regular maintenance to preserve its beauty and functionality. Keeping the surface clean is essential; wiping it down with a damp cloth and mild dish soap helps to remove spills and stains. To maintain the integrity of the wood, periodic treatment with a food-safe mineral oil or beeswax is recommended, aiding in the prevention of cracks and drying.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ners as they can damage the finish. Additionally, paying attention to the hinges and wheels is crucial; a bit of silicone lubricant can keep the cart’s mobility smooth and its components rust-free.

For the Americana Kitchen Island, the combination of white and oak finishes adds elegance but requires similar attention in maintenance. Regularly dusting with a soft cloth is advisable to keep surfaces free from grime. Like the mobile cart, applying food-safe mineral oil to the wooden surface regularly is effective in maintaining the wood's texture and preventing moisture absorption, which can lead to warping. Special care should be taken to ensure that the storage drawers are clean and functional; a quick check for any obstructions and periodic lubrication can enhance their smooth operation. The adjustable shelves also benefit from careful organization, ensuring that weight distribution is even to avoid unnecessary stress on the shelving system.
